Zara Reveals Military-Inspired "SRPLS" Collection

Zara has revealed its first ever “SRPLS” collection, with the military-inspired pieces highlighted in a new lookbook. The collection’s military theme is referenced through the use of camouflage, cargo pants and utilitarian knitwear throughout. The color palette — mostly khaki, black and green — also nods to this influence.

Other features of the collection include “ZARA SRPLS” branding on tags, belts and graphic prints, as well as accessories including hats and baggage. The new collection will release exclusively via the Zara web store, and will be made available in weekly drops beginning on November 15.
